Login error on BIP Server (10.1.3.4.2) when Siebel Security Model is enabled.
(Doc ID 1468508.1)
Last updated on JANUARY 29, 2022
Applies to:
Siebel Reports - Version 8.1.1.5 SIA [21229] and laterSiebel Sales - Version 8.1.1.11.12 [IP2013] to 8.1.1.11.12 [IP2013] [Release V8]
Information in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
Under the following conditions, login to BI Publisher Server may fail with "(500)Internal Server Error" as below.
- Siebel Reports 8.1.1.5 and later is integrated with BI Publisher 10.1.3.4.2.
- Security Model for BI Publisher login is " Siebel Security".
- Siebel Web Service Endpoint has been set based on Siebel Reports Guide.
